Friday Night Football

Carlisle’s challenge has changed after a breakthrough season. The Indians went 10-3 in 2025 and reached a Division V regional semifinal while producing one of the SWBL’s most explosive offenses. Running back Alex Collins returns after leading the league with 1,566 rushing yards, giving Carlisle an established centerpiece after an offseason that brought change elsewhere in the backfield. The Indians amassed 2,885 rushing yards and 2,377 passing yards last season, finishing among the league leaders in both categories. Carlisle’s 2025 run included wins over Oakwood, Waynesville and Franklin before a 40-36 postseason loss to North Union. The Indians are no longer trying to prove they can contend. The question is whether they can turn last season’s breakthrough into sustained success. 

Need to know: Collins gives Carlisle one of the league’s premiers returning offensive weapons after a 1,566-yard junior season.
